About The Position

ASM Global, the leader in privately managed public assembly facilities, has an excellent and immediate opening for a Food & Beverage Supervisor at the Shreveport Convention Center/Municipal Auditorium in Shreveport, Louisiana. Under direction of the Food & Beverage Manager/Director of Food & Beverage, the Food & Beverage Supervisor team member's primary responsibilities include the following functions in accordance with ASM policies.

Requirements

  • Must be able to pass background check and drug screen.
  • Strong customer service orientation with ability to be a team player.
  • Advanced oral and written communication skills.
  • Consistent attention to detail.
  • Excellent organizational, planning, communication, and inter-personal skills.
  • Ability to undertake and complete multiple tasks.
  • Must possess, or have the ability to obtain within allotted time; Shreveport ABO Card, Louisiana Responsible Vendor Permit (LACT), and be Serv-Safe Certified.
  • Must possess a valid Louisiana Drivers License.
  • Minimum of 2 years' experience in a Food and Beverage management.
  • Catering management experience is required
  • Proven track record of exceeding customer service and quality standards required
  • Knowledge of Microsoft Office
  • Excel/Word required

Responsibilities

  • Responsible for interviewing, training all F&B captains, servers, bartenders, and concessions personnel.
  • Supervises the part-time staff, contracted staff and guest in the areas of concessions and catering.
  • Understand and assist in maintaining budgeted goals.
  • Access needs of the department, order product, and maintain proper par levels.
  • Maintain equipment through proper cleaning and scheduled maintenance.
  • Maintain cash handling procedures.
  • Fulfilling service requirements per each Banquet Event Orders (BEO).
  • Maintains inventory control procedures.
  • Must be creative design of food service areas, concession signage, and displays.
  • Attention to detail and consistency in every area.
  • Position is very hands on with excessive interaction with staff and customers
  • Review and work along with staff to ensure execution of all F&B operations through banquet event orders and contractual obligations such as services, equipment orders, consumption reports and special orders.
  • Monitors in-house events, maintaining close contact with clients and facility staff to ensure success while ensuring on all client requests, concerns, and problems are addressed.
  • Attends appropriate planning, organization, event and facility meetings in support of food and beverage elements.
  • Directs and work along with staff for proper cleaning techniques and procedures to ensure passing health inspections by State and local agencies and ASM Global guidelines
  • Act as Department Manager and/or Manager on Duty for events, including banquets, backstage catering, concessions, and other activities as deemed necessary by department and facilities
  • Payroll
  • Responsible for conducting monthly inventory.
  • Maintaining labor cost
